Can't I just use mothballs?
Sure. If you want to keep facing the problem over and over again. Mothballs are a temporary relief to your problem, at best. They will quickly dissipate and the smell will be non- threatening to the target animal. Most wildlife become accustomed to the smell and it does not affect them long term. Is there any type of wildlife you will not deal with?
Alligators, bears, panthers, gopher tortoises and or any other Florida federally protected wildlife.
Each county has a state-licensed trapper that will remove the alligator at no charge to you and can get it done quicker than we can.
Please contact the FL Fish and Wildlife Conservation Commission if you have a nuisance alligator. Their website is https://myfwc.com/ and they can be reached at (863) 462-0015.
I found/have an injured animal, what do I do with it?
First and foremost, do not put yourself or other people at risk trying to handle an injured animal! This is a time when they are most likely to defend themselves to survive. Most birds are best left alone. They do not survive well in captivity. Most rehabilitators will only deal with predatory birds such as eagles, hawks, ospreys, and
owls.
